SCULPTRA® in London

Smooth, firm and restore youthful volume naturally with SCULPTRA®

SCULPTRA® is an injectable collagen stimulator made from poly-L-lactic acid (PLLA). Rather than filling lines or folds directly, SCULPTRA® works by stimulating your body’s own natural collagen production over time, restoring facial structure and volume gradually for a more youthful, refreshed appearance.

Unlike hyaluronic acid fillers that provide instant volume, SCULPTRA® delivers subtle, long-lasting results by rebuilding the skin’s internal scaffolding. Results typically appear over a series of treatments and can last up to two years or more.

It is ideal for patients looking for natural, progressive enhancement in areas that show signs of ageing, such as hollow cheeks, temple loss, jawline softening, or skin laxity on the face and body. SCULPTRA® is also increasingly used off-label in areas such as the décolleté, arms, and buttocks to improve skin firmness and texture.

A course of 2-4 sessions is often recommended for optimal results.

SCULPTRA® is made from poly-L-lactic acid (PLLA), a biocompatible synthetic material that’s gradually absorbed by the body while stimulating collagen production.

Most patients require 2 to 4  sessions spaced around 8 weeks apart for optimal collagen stimulation and volume restoration. The number of vials that you will likely need will be discussed at your consultation.

SCULPTRA® works gradually. You may begin to notice subtle improvements within a few weeks, with full results appearing over several months.

Results can last over 2 years, depending on the individual’s skin condition, age, lifestyle and number of treatment sessions.

SCULPTRA® is injected with a fine needle or cannula, and a local anaesthetic is  mixed with the product to reduce discomfort. Most patients report minimal pain.

SCULPTRA® results develop gradually, so changes are subtle and natural-looking. People may comment on how well-rested or refreshed you look, without knowing why.

Yes. SCULPTRA® can be part of a holistic facial rejuvenation plan and is often combined with other injectable or skin treatments.

Avoid alcohol, aspirin or anti-inflammatories for 24-48 hours before treatment to minimise the risk of bruising. Arrive with clean skin.

You’ll be advised to massage the treated area for five minutes, five times a day, for five days. Avoid strenuous exercise and excessive sun or heat exposure for 24-48 hours post-treatment.
